Wheeler's Wycombe Breweries Ltd, 91/92 Easton Street, High Wycombe, Buckinghamshire.
Founded in late 18th century as Biddle and King although originally owned by the Wells family in 17th century.
Registered July 1898 to merge Wheeler & Co. and Leadbetter & Bird.
Acquired by Ashby's Staines Brewery Ltd. October 1929 with 148 tied houses and brewing ceased 1931.
